Description | The following set of briefing papers describes the work performed by Ecology’s Environmental Investigations and Laboratory Services Program staff for the Water Quality Program and others over the past ten years in the Upper and Lower Yakima Water Quality Management Areas (WQMAs). Also included are short reviews of other sources of water quality data for the WQMAs. | ||||
